Personal Background

Jack Kolbeck holds a bachelor's degree in business from South Dakota State University and began his career in the beer distribution industry in Sioux Falls. He spent several years in this sector before transitioning to public service. Kolbeck has been a member of the Republican Party and was appointed to the South Dakota House of Representatives in February 2025. He and his wife Muriel have three children.
